I noticed at the end of a journey yesterday where there were no problems, that quite suddenly the engine cut out as I was taking off. I was able to get home by keeping the revs high but it kept it was behaving erratically as if there was a fuel problem. I started the car this morning and the same problem was there. It started but it kept cutting out. My neighbour who knows a bit about cars said it sounds like an oil filter problem.
Any help appreciated |

hey is ur car air flow metered, try another one and see
have you popped a vacuum line off if your car is afm check to see if there's any leaks after the airflow meter... get some engine start and spray some around the inlet manifold and vacuum lines etc, if you spray some and the revs pick up it has a leak that you'll have to remedy oil blockages don't generally cause an engine to stall, the most they do is drop in oil pressure and you'll have a nice heavy paperweight to play with well there's a couple of ideas to try anyway ![]() hope it helps some
